ORDER SETTING EARLY SETTLEMENT CONFERENCE AND STAY signed by Senior Judge William B. Shubb on 2/9/2016: The parties shall contact the assigned magistrate judge's courtroom deputy no later than 3/1/2016, by phone or email to schedule an early s ettlement conference. The early settlement conference shall be conducted no later than 4/1/2016. The court hereby resets the Status (Pretrial Scheduling) Conference for 5/9/2016 at 01:30 PM in Courtroom 5 (WBS) before Senior Judge William B. Shubb. If a settlement is not reached at the early settlement conference, the parties shall submit an Amended Joint Status Report no later than 4/25/2016. (Kirksey Smith, K)
